As a Facilities Project Manager II, you will:
• Plan, track, and evaluate all assigned projects to include Scope & Budget development, design & construction awards & execution at the Howard University Hospital facilities.
• Plan and manage a wide range of construction projects to complete on schedule and within budget from start to finish.
• Ensure progression of construction projects, using critical skills in project management, transition management, space planning, medical equipment planning, IT/ Security coordination, furniture management, signage planning, and compliance with design standards.
• Prepare & communicate required information to client representatives and entity leadership to determine resources, method of delivery, and project status.  • Coordinate with end-users / Adventist Healthcare departments on all aspects of project delivery.
• Must be well-versed in construction methodologies and procedures and able to coordinate a team of professionals of different disciplines, including third-party consultants/vendors, to achieve the best results.
• Coordinate the project closeout process to ensure that project scope and quality standards are met and that proper end-user transition is achieved.
• Develop forms and records to document project activities.   Set up files in eBuilder or other Project Management Software systems to ensure that all project information is appropriately documented and secured.
• Establish and prepare a communication schedule to update stakeholders, including appropriate staff in the organization, on the status of current and upcoming projects.
• Additional duties as assigned

Qualifications include:
• Associate Degree in Construction-Related Field,
• Bachelor’s Degree in Construction Management, Arch, Mechanical, Electrical, or Civil Engineering, preferred.
• 3-8 years’ experience managing construction projects in the healthcare industry, required.
• Registered Architect, Professional Engineer, or Project Management Professional (PMP), preferred.
• Project Manager in the Construction-Related Field
• Construction Management or Arch, MEP, Civil Engineering concept, preferred.
• Project Budgeting and Cost Estimating, preferred
• Knowledge of project management life cycles, project processes, construction, scope development, scheduling, budgets, multidisciplinary coordination, and resource management, preferred.
• Experience in a healthcare setting and understanding of healthcare safety and infection prevention protocols are preferred

Tobacco and Drug Statement

Tobacco use is a well-recognized preventable cause of death in the United States and an important public health issue. In order to promote and maintain a healthy work environment, Adventist HealthCare will not hire applicants for employment who either state that they are nicotine users or who test positive for nicotine and drug use.

 

While some jurisdictions, including Maryland, permit the use of marijuana for medical purposes, marijuana continues to be classified as an illegal drug under the federal Controlled Substances Act.  As a result, medical marijuana use will not be accepted as a valid explanation for a positive drug test result.

 

Adventist HealthCare will withdraw offers of employment to applicants who test positive for Cotinine (nicotine) and marijuana. Those testing positive are given the opportunity to re-apply in 90 days, if they can truthfully attest that they have not used any nicotine products in the past ninety (90) days and successfully pass follow-up testing. ("Nicotine products" include, but are not limited to: cigarettes, cigars, pipes, chewing tobacco, e-cigarettes, vaping products, hookah, and nicotine replacement products (e.g., nicotine gum, nicotine patches, nicotine lozenges, etc.).
